If gas escapes at high temperature, there is a risk of life-threatening burns. You
may suffer burn injuries in the event of contact with hot surfaces.
• Allow the components to cool down before working in the system.
• Wear personal protective equipment.
If connections not required during operation remain open, gas will escape. Risk of
explosion and intoxication!
• Before start up, seal all open connections with certified blind plugs according to
94/9/EC.
• Replace the blind plugs that have been installed for transportation with certified
blind plugs according to 94/9/EC or NEC500.
5.4.3

Hazards during start up

If personnel that have insufficient qualifications carry out work, they can incorrectly
assess the hazards. Explosions can occur.
• Carry out the work only if you have the respective qualification and are a spe-
cialist person.
If the device is not sealed correctly during installation, then gas may escape. Ex-
plosions can occur. Danger of poisoning!
• Check the connections for leaks.
• Take the system immediately out of operation if you detect a leak.
